Just out of curiosity, what language doesn't call "bytes" "bytes"? And what's the translation into that language?
In French, we call a byte an "octet" (plural octets) and in short "o".
Also, wouldn't Mb, Gb and Tb need to be translated as well in this case?
Yes, it is why, in the subject I say "(byte,b)", I translate byte to octet and b to o --> Mo, Go, To.. :)
